Side note - those canned fish, salmon and mackerel, are some of the healthiest eating you can buy on the cheap also. Packed in oil or tomatoe sauce they are chuck full of good Omega 3 & 6 oils. Very healthy.
Also, I get the ones in tomatoe sauce and separate the sauce out. Drain the red sauce, add it to a pan with some oil, some garlic a bit of water and heat. Stir in some flour or cornstarch and keep stirring. With the right herbs added - I use the pre-packed "Italian Seasoning" or "Herbs du Provence" or maybe just some simple Lemon Pepper - and you can whip up some mighty good tasting sauce for the fish.
